    WWE NXT 2.0 Results: Tony D'Angelo Promotes Stacks & Two Dimes, Bron Breakker Retains NXT Championship In Record Time, Cameron Grimes Calls For Title Shot (06/14)
    Share
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n WhatsApp Pinterest Email

    Tony D’Angelo has made something crystal clear after absorbing Legado Del Fantasma into his gang. However tonight is about Two Dimes & Stacks, his trusted men. They are set for promotions here tonight for their services to the don.

    Two Dimes & Stacks Promoted To “Soldiers Of The Family”

    Two Dimes would get hyped up first, D’Angelo saying he met him at 4. Stacks was a friend since 6. Since D’Angelo made the call, they stepped up big for the family. All while the chant of Legado went through the arena. D’Angelo promoted them both to ‘Soldiers of the Family’.

    Meanwhile, Legado got verbally dressed down for being disloyal to the family – but were offered some handshakes and after Escobar stared daggers into D’Angelo. After this, D’Angelo announced he is fixing to become the NXT North American Champion.

    Carmelo Hayes & Trick Williams would come to the ring, and after D’Angelo claimed he calls the shots and made a title match for next week. However, Two Dimes & Stacks called for a match tonight – and a tag team match will come later tonight.

    Bron Breakker Rips Through Duke Hudson – Cameron Grimes To Challenge At Great American Bash

    Bron Breakker is not yet finished with Duke Hudson after their match last month. Breakker lost the match, but only due to a DQ caused by Joe Gacy. Tonight, Duke Hudson gets his rematch – and a chance to become NXT Champion. The Australian powerhouse has shown some crazy skills in the ring previously, and with the big stakes of tonight – is fixing to have his best performance ever.

    Hudson would attack before the bell, but just fired the champ up. Breakker would hit a German Suplex, before cutting Hudson down with a spear. He’d press slam Hudson into a powerslam, and just like that – this match was already over! After the match, Cameron Grimes would hit the ring with something to say.

    Since Bron Breakker tore through NXT, Grimes has been wanting a word with him. Grimes feels he’s a champion just because his last name. Because his family is Hall of Famers. Meanwhile, Grimes worked for everything, because his dad wasn’t someone famous.

    The dad of Grimes never got the chance to watch from the crowd to win gold, instead watching from above. Grimes is tired of catchphrases, and if it’s time to launch the rocket and go to the moon – he needs the gold. The challenge was set for Great American Bash, and Breakker accepts.
